The Ultimate Minimalist To-Do List

Feeling overwhelmed by endless todos? It's time to embrace the power of minimalism! A minimalist to-do list is merely about focusing on the topconcerns items that truly count your day. By keeping it concise, you'll avoid mental clutter and keep your mind clear.

  • Begin your day by jotting down 3-5 action items.
  • Prioritize those tasks based on their relevance.
  • Observe your progress throughout the day and appreciate your successes!

With a minimalist to-do list, you'll experience the freedom of a clearintention and accomplish your goals with newfound grace.

Your Daily To-Do List

Life can get pretty overwhelming sometimes. There are always things to do, and it's easy to feel like you're constantly playing catch up. But what if I told you there was a way to simplify your day and make things a little bit easier? It all starts with a simple checklist.

A daily checklist can be your best ally in staying on top of everything. It allows you to divide large tasks into smaller, more manageable pieces.

This makes them feel less daunting and achievable. Here's how to keep it simple:
